Bookkeeper for Small Business
Worldwide
The Bookkeeper will be responsible for maintaining accurate financial records, supporting tax preparation, managing billing, tracking income and expenses, and assisting with customer and tenant-related financial matters. We are looking for someone who is organized, professional, responsive, and able to keep financial records current and accurate. This person must be comfortable working in a real estate and property management environment where details matter. Key Responsibilities Maintain accurate bookkeeping records for real estate and property management operations Track rental income, property expenses, vendor invoices, deposits, reimbursements, and owner payments Prepare billing statements, invoices, receipts, and account summaries Reconcile bank accounts, credit cards, rent payments, and vendor payments Organize financial documents for tax preparation and year-end reporting Assist with accounts payable and accounts receivable Maintain tenant, owner, vendor, and property-related financial records Support property management reporting, including income and expense tracking by property Communicate professionally with tenants, vendors, owners, and internal team members Help resolve billing questions, payment issues, account discrepancies, and customer service matters Coordinate with accountants, tax preparers, property managers, and company leadership Maintain organized digital files and proper documentation for audits, taxes, and reporting Required Experience Candidates should have experience with: Bookkeeping for real estate, property management, construction, or small business operations Rent collection tracking, vendor payments, and property-level accounting Tax preparation support and year-end document organization Billing, invoicing, account reconciliation, and financial reporting Customer relations, tenant communications, and vendor follow-up QuickBooks, Excel, Google Workspace, or similar accounting and office tools Qualifications 3+ years of bookkeeping experience preferred Real estate or property management bookkeeping experience strongly preferred Strong attention to detail and accuracy Ability to keep records organized and current Professional communication skills Comfortable handling confidential financial information Ability to work independently and meet deadlines Experience with QuickBooks or similar accounting software preferred Ideal Candidate The ideal candidate is dependable, accurate, and practical. They understand that clean books are the foundation of good business decisions, tax preparation, investor reporting, and property management operations. This person should be comfortable working with tenants, vendors, owners, accountants, and management while keeping financial records organized and up to date. Position Type Part-Time, Full-Time, or Contract depending on experience and availability. Compensation will be based on experience and scope of responsibilities.
